Output 80d896f6ae45ecc38efbedee208d9ff4ed43dfc7f2464a12db132feb1db80153:21

value
633
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 93cc6cca97e9f608f0193d17ad6b53930b1b27e443289ec691a5c458310b84ed
address
bc1pj0xxej5ha8mq3uqe85t6666njv93kflygv5fa3535hz9svgtsnksxmr8xl
transaction
80d896f6ae45ecc38efbedee208d9ff4ed43dfc7f2464a12db132feb1db80153
spent
true